NASA has moved the Artemis II rocket to the launch pad at Kennedy Space Center following an overnight transport. Engineers are now preparing for critical fueling and countdown tests. Scheduled as the first crewed mission of the program, Artemis II will send four astronauts on a journey around the Moon and back. This mission is a vital milestone in NASA’s long-term strategy to return humans to the lunar surface and eventually send crews to Mars.
